On Tue, 2004-09-21 at 14:05 -0400, Daniel Veillard wrote: > - giop_send_buffer_write in libORBit-2 leading to > Syscall param writev(vector[...]) contains uninitialised or unaddressable byte(s) > that time the uninitialized data is 10 bytes inside a block of size 2048 > allocated within orbit itself. For "performance reason" orbit doesn't initialize padding bytes. To make it do this, build with --enable-purify. =-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-= Alexander Larsson Red Hat, Inc alexl@xxxxxxxxxx alla@xxxxxxxxxxxxxx He's a time-tossed drug-addicted vagrant looking for a cure to the poison coursing through his veins.
